Learn to Draw Realism
Realism can be difficult for some young artists to achieve. These lessons are designed to enhance sketching talents and help students to learn how to efficiently sketch realistic drawings.

Students should have basic art knowledge, such as the usage of different types of pencils, paper and proportions.
Sketchbook or blank white paper. Shaded paper is also acceptable. Graphite pencils of varying types, such as 2b, f or 5h. Erasers, Q-Tip's, toilet paper and other shading products.
Will reference pictures of faces and animals, for students to base their realism on.
